Meeting and Pickup Information

guided-boat-trip-and-walk

The tour begins at the Historium Bruges on Markt 1 in Brugge, Belgium. Travelers should look for the guide holding a sign for "City Tours Belgium".

The meeting point is conveniently located 1.6 km (1 mile) from the train station and 21 km (13 miles) from the port.

However, the tour isn’t wheelchair accessible, though strollers and service animals are allowed. Guests are advised to dress warmly, as the boat tour may be affected by weather conditions.

The tour ends at the Huisbrouwerij De Halve Maan, providing a full experience of Bruges’ historic sights and attractions.

Exploring Bruges by Boat

guided-boat-trip-and-walk

  1. Admire Bruges’ iconic landmarks, like the Belfry and Church of Our Lady, from the water.

  2. Gain insight into the city’s history and development, as the guide shares commentary about notable sights.

  3. Capture stunning photos of the charming, canal-lined streets that are inaccessible on foot.

The boat tour complements the walking portion, giving visitors a well-rounded experience of Bruges’ charms.
